Veteran Texas House staffer and government affairs pro Mae Beth Palone passed away
Thanks to Steve
Scurlock with the Independent Bankers Association of Texas
for passing along the sad news:
"With a heavy heart, we
report the passing of Mae Beth Palone, who served IBAT faithfully and
well from 1994 until her retirement in 2017. Mae Beth passed away Sunday
morning from injuries sustained in a car accident last week. Mae Beth loved her
family, her hometown of Sweetwater, the State of Texas, the University of Texas
Longhorns and community bankers. She was never more proud than when playing mother hen to the men and women
who led the IBAT Leadership Division. Under her leadership, the LD grew to
almost 600 members and raised countless PAC dollars to support community
banking in Texas.
Mae Beth was feisty and
funny, a gifted writer and a friend of par excellence. We are grateful for her
gifts and her life. We will miss our friend. Details
on arrangements for the celebration of Mae Beth’s life are pending."
For over 20 years, she
worked for Representatives Elmer Martin, Walter Grubbs, Jimmy Mankins,
and Foster Whaley. She culminated her House career as Chief of Staff to Robert
Earley, per her
obituary.
